Salford City have signed goalkeeper Sam Long on a two-year deal.

The 23-year-old joins from Bromley, having been part of their promotion-winning 2025-26 squad that won the League Two title.

Prior to his time with Bromley, where he made 13 appearances, Long began his career with Lincoln City.

"Last season with Bromley was an incredible experience, it was a great thing to be a part of and hopefully I can do it again," he told the club website., external
